Add 75/5 and 56/9

1st number: 15 0/5, 2nd number: 6 2/9

75/5 + 56/9 is 191/9.

Steps for adding fractions

  1.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
    LCM of 5 and 9 is 45

    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 45
  2. For the 1st fraction, since 5 × 9 = 45,
    75/5 = 75 × 9/5 × 9 = 675/45
  3.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 9 × 5 = 45,
    56/9 = 56 × 5/9 × 5 = 280/45
  4. Add the two like fractions:
    675/45 + 280/45 = 675 + 280/45 = 955/45
  5. 955/45 simplified gives 191/9
  6. So, 75/5 + 56/9 = 191/9
